在Linux下使用Zookeeper进行日志管理,通常涉及到以下几个步骤:
安装Zookeeper: 首先,你需要在你的Linux系统上安装Zookeeper。你可以从Apache Zookeeper的官方网站下载最新版本的Zookeeper,并按照官方文档的指导进行安装。
配置Zookeeper: 安装完成后,你需要配置Zookeeper。配置文件通常位于/etc/zookeeper/conf目录下,主要的配置文件是zoo.cfg。在这个文件中,你可以设置Zookeeper的各种参数,比如数据目录、客户端端口等。
启动Zookeeper: 配置完成后,你可以启动Zookeeper服务。在大多数Linux发行版中,你可以使用systemd或者init脚本来管理服务。例如,使用systemd,你可以运行以下命令来启动Zookeeper:
sudo systemctl start zookeeper 确保Zookeeper服务启动成功,并且状态是active。
集成日志管理工具: 要使用Zookeeper进行日志管理,你需要一个能够与Zookeeper集成的日志管理工具。例如,Apache Flume、Logstash或者Apache NiFi等都可以与Zookeeper配合使用来管理日志。
配置日志管理工具: 根据你选择的日志管理工具,你需要进行相应的配置,以便它能够使用Zookeeper。这通常涉及到编辑配置文件,指定Zookeeper的地址和端口等信息。
启动日志管理工具: 配置完成后,你可以启动你的日志管理工具。确保它能够成功连接到Zookeeper,并且开始正常工作。
监控和维护: 一旦你的日志管理系统运行起来,你需要监控其性能和状态,并定期进行维护。Zookeeper可以帮助你监控集群的健康状况,并在节点故障时提供服务发现和协调功能。
请注意,具体的安装和配置步骤可能会根据你使用的Linux发行版、Zookeeper版本以及日志管理工具的不同而有所差异。建议参考官方文档和社区指南来获取最准确的指导。